Support for Popular Fonts and Styles
  Aspose.OCR
 for Java supports Arial, Times New Roman and Tahoma fonts in regular, 
bold and italic text styles. 32pt font size is supported.
    Platform Independence
  Aspose.OCR
 for Java together with Aspose.OCR for .NET cover the main development 
environments and deployment platforms in common use today.
 Aspose.OCR
 for Java is available for Java 1.6 and 1.7 and will run on any place 
where Java Runtime is installed. Please note that Aspose.OCR for Java is
 compatible with JDK1.6 and JDK1.7 versions.
